What is the best season to walk in Tom Wright Reserve?
The best season to walk in Tom Wright Reserve is during the cooler months from April to October when the weather is milder and more suitable for outdoor activities.
What are the typical weather conditions to prepare for in Tom Wright Reserve?
In Tom Wright Reserve, you should prepare for warm and dry summers with temperatures reaching over 30°C, and milder winters with occasional rainfall. It's important to bring sunscreen and stay hydrated during the hot summer months.
